如何快速下载B站视频:BilibiliDown完整使用指南
BilibiliDown是一款免费开源的B站视频下载工具,支持Windows、Linux和Mac多平台,能够轻松下载B站视频、音频及弹幕,支持稍后再看、收藏夹、UP主视频批量下载等功能,让你随时随地离线观看喜爱的内容。
🚀 为什么选择BilibiliDown?
BilibiliDown作为一款专业的B站视频下载神器,具有以下核心优势:
- 多平台支持:完美兼容Windows、Linux和Mac系统,满足不同用户的使用需求。
- 丰富的下载功能:不仅能下载单个视频,还支持批量下载UP主所有视频、收藏夹视频、稍后再看列表等。
- 高清画质:支持多种清晰度选择,从流畅到1080P高清,满足你对视频质量的不同要求。
- 弹幕下载:可同时下载视频弹幕,让离线观看体验与在线无异。
- 简洁易用:图形化界面设计,操作简单直观,即使是新手也能快速上手。
📥 快速安装步骤
环境准备
在开始安装BilibiliDown之前,请确保你的系统已安装Java运行环境(JRE 1.8或更高版本)。
获取项目源码
通过以下命令克隆项目仓库到本地:
git clone https://gitcode.com/gh_mirrors/bi/BilibiliDown
运行程序
- 进入项目目录:
cd BilibiliDown
- 根据你的操作系统选择相应的启动方式:
- Windows系统:双击
release目录下的可执行文件。 - Mac系统:运行
release/Double-Click-to-Run-for-Mac.command。 - Linux系统:执行
release/Create-Shortcut-on-Desktop-for-Linux.sh创建桌面快捷方式,然后双击快捷方式运行。
🌟 功能介绍与使用教程
登录B站账号
使用BilibiliDown下载需要登录B站账号,支持扫码登录和账号密码登录两种方式。
- 打开BilibiliDown后,点击界面上的"登录"按钮。
- 在弹出的登录窗口中,选择"扫码登录"。
- 使用B站APP扫描显示的二维码,确认登录即可。
单个视频下载
下载单个B站视频非常简单,只需几步即可完成:
- 复制你要下载的B站视频链接。
- 在BilibiliDown主界面的输入框中粘贴链接,点击"解析"按钮。
- 解析完成后,选择你需要的清晰度和下载格式(视频+音频或仅音频)。
- 点击"下载"按钮,视频将开始下载。你可以在"下载"标签页查看下载进度。
批量下载UP主所有视频
如果你喜欢某个UP主的所有视频,可以使用批量下载功能一次性下载:
- 在BilibiliDown主界面,点击"UP主所有视频"按钮。
- 输入UP主的UID或主页链接,点击"解析"。
- 解析完成后,你可以选择要下载的视频范围和清晰度。
- 点击"批量下载"按钮,程序将自动开始下载所选视频。
下载收藏夹视频
BilibiliDown还支持一键下载你的B站收藏夹视频:
- 登录后,点击"收藏夹"按钮。
- 选择你要下载的收藏夹。
- 选择下载设置,点击"下载"即可开始批量下载收藏夹中的所有视频。
视频清晰度设置
BilibiliDown支持多种视频清晰度选择,你可以根据自己的需求和网络状况进行设置:
- 在解析视频后,点击"清晰度"下拉菜单。
- 选择你需要的清晰度,如"1080P"、"720P"、"480P"等。
- 如果你希望默认使用某种清晰度,可以在"设置"中进行配置。
⚙️ 高级设置与优化
下载路径设置
你可以自定义视频的下载路径,方便管理下载的视频文件:
- 点击主界面的"设置"按钮。
- 在设置界面中,找到"下载路径"选项。
- 点击"浏览"选择你希望保存视频的文件夹。
- 点击"确定"保存设置。
同时下载多个视频
BilibiliDown支持同时下载多个视频,你可以在设置中调整最大同时下载数量:
- 打开"设置"界面。
- 找到"下载设置"中的"最大同时下载数"。
- 根据你的网络状况和电脑性能,调整合适的数值。
- 保存设置后,程序将按照新的设置进行多任务下载。
💡 常见问题与解决方法
下载速度慢怎么办?
如果遇到下载速度慢的问题,可以尝试以下解决方法:
- 检查你的网络连接,确保网络稳定。
- 减少同时下载的视频数量。
- 在设置中降低视频清晰度,选择较小的视频文件进行下载。
无法解析视频链接怎么办?
如果无法解析视频链接,可能是以下原因导致:
- 视频链接不正确,请检查并重新复制链接。
- 视频可能已被删除或设置为私密,无法公开访问。
- 你可能需要登录才能访问该视频,请确保已成功登录B站账号。
更多常见问题及解决方法,请参考项目中的Q&A文档。
🛠️ 项目结构与源码介绍
BilibiliDown的主要源码位于src目录下,核心功能模块包括:
- B站API交互:src/nicelee/bilibili/API.java
- 视频下载器:src/nicelee/bilibili/downloaders/
- 用户界面:src/nicelee/ui/
- 网络请求工具:src/nicelee/bilibili/util/HttpRequestUtil.java
📝 更新日志
BilibiliDown会定期更新,修复bug并增加新功能。最新的更新日志可以查看项目根目录下的UPDATE.md文件。
📄 开源协议
BilibiliDown遵循Apache 2.0开源协议,详细的协议内容可以查看LICENSE文件。第三方库的使用声明和许可协议位于release/LICENSE/third-party目录下。
🎉 总结
BilibiliDown是一款功能强大、操作简单的B站视频下载工具,无论你是想离线观看视频,还是备份喜爱的内容,它都能满足你的需求。希望本指南能帮助你快速掌握BilibiliDown的使用方法,享受更便捷的B站视频下载体验!
如果你在使用过程中遇到任何问题,欢迎查阅项目的帮助文档或提交issue反馈。祝使用愉快!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考







